Thin stone veneer installation involves attaching a layer of natural or manufactured stone to the exterior or interior surfaces of a property. This process typically includes preparing the existing surface, applying a suitable adhesive or mortar, and carefully placing the stone veneer to ensure a secure and visually appealing finish. The result is a durable, attractive surface that mimics the look of full-sized stone while requiring less material and weight. Skilled local contractors can handle the entire installation, ensuring that the veneer is properly aligned and securely affixed for long-lasting beauty.
This service helps address several common problems homeowners face with their property exteriors. For example, it can improve the aesthetic appeal of a home’s façade, giving it a more refined and timeless appearance. Thin stone veneer also provides an extra layer of protection against weather elements, helping to insulate and shield walls from moisture infiltration. Additionally, it can be used to repair or cover damaged or deteriorating surfaces, preventing further structural issues and enhancing the overall cur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Thin Stone Veneer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sylvania,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for small veneer repairs or patchwork in Sylvania, OH range from $250 to $600. Many routine projects fall within this range, especially for minor touch-ups or replacing small sections.
Standard Installation - Installing thin stone veneer on an entire wall or façade usually costs between $1,200 and $3,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this middle range.
Full Wall or Surface Coverings - Larger, more comprehensive veneer installations can range from $3,500 to $8,000, depending on surface size and complexity. Fewer projects extend into this higher tier, often involving detailed work or custom designs.
Complete Exterior Renovations - Whole-home or extensive exterior veneer projects in Sylvania can reach $8,000 or more, with larger, intricate jobs potentially exceeding $15,000. These are less common but represent the upper end of typical project cost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is thin stone veneer installation? Thin stone veneer installation involves attaching lightweight stone panels to surfaces such as walls or facades to enhance appearance and durability.
What surfaces are suitable for thin stone veneer? Thin stone veneer can be installed on various surfaces including concrete, brick, and wood frameworks, depending on the project requirements.
How long does thin stone veneer installation typically take? The duration of installation depends on the scope of the project and the complexity of the surface, which local contractors can assess during consultation.
What preparation is needed before installing thin stone veneer? Preparation may include cleaning the surface, ensuring proper structural support, and applying a suitable backing or adhesive as recommended by local service providers.
Can thin stone veneer be installed indoors and outdoors? Yes, thin stone veneer is versatile and can be used for both interior accent walls and exterior facades, with local contractors advising on appropriate materials and techniques.
